Are you looking for a fun, rewarding career dedicated to helping children reach their full potential? If so, we want YOU to join us as a RBT at Lighthouse Autism Center! As a RBT, you will work with a team of clinicians and behavior analysts to provide high‑quality, center‑based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) therapy to children with autism. You will receive all the training you need to play an integral role in helping children learn new skills and reach their goals. Responsibilities

Work one‑on‑one with kids (18 months to school age) to provide ABA therapy in a center‑based approach.

Collaborate with a team of clinicians and behavior analysts to implement custom therapy plans unique to the needs of each child.

Use creativity and enthusiasm in a play‑based and naturalistic therapy setting.

Help children progress in educational and social settings and prepare them to transition to a more traditional school setting.

Track and document progress for each child as you implement custom therapy programs.

What We Bring

Paid training to help ensure you are confident and successful as you earn your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) Certification and begin your career in ABA therapy, with additional training as you progress through our career levels.

Tuition reimbursement toward master’s‑level education in a needed field. If you have the drive and desire, Lighthouse will support you through BCBA Certification.

Competitive salary with opportunities for advancement and growth—in only 3 to 15 months, you could climb from Trainee to RBT Trainer with pay raises along the way!

Benefits that start on day one: health, dental, and vision insurance, $20,000 life insurance coverage at no cost to you, Employee Assistance Program (EAP), and a 401(k) retirement plan with company match after 30 days.

Generous time off: 3 weeks earned Paid Time Off (PTO) annually, 8 paid holidays per year, and paid parental leave.

Full‑time schedule, Monday through Friday, and 40+ hours per week.

Requirements

Lifting/carrying more than 50 lbs. and sustaining physical activity such as running, crouching, squatting, kneeling, and bending; ability to move quickly from standing to seated or kneeling without support; full range of motion of hands and arms; sit on the floor and chair for long periods; communicate expressively both verbally and written.

Reliable transportation and a valid driver’s license preferred.

Safety is a priority at Lighthouse: background check and drug test at the time of hire.

Salary $18.00‑$20.00 per hour
